HL Deb 14 August 1894 vol 28 cc892-3

House in Committee (according to Order).

* LORD BALFOUR OF BURLEIGH

As the Lord President had stated yesterday his willingness to answer questions, I should like to ask what is the object of Clause 5 of the Bill which repeals provisions in former Acts authorising grants of lands for churches and chapels on certain conditions? As he had not given notice he would postpone it if desired.

THE EARL OF ROSEBERY

suggested that the noble Lord should put down his Amendment for Third Reading. Though prepared yesterday, he was not enabled to answer questions on this occasion.

Bill reported without amendment.

Standing Committee negatived, and Bill to be read 3a on Thursday next.
